What is hydroponic hemp, why has smuggling increased? 25 kg seized from Hyderabad

25 kg hydroponic ganja has been seized in Hyderabad. It is also called hydro hemp. This action has been taken by the Directorate of Revenue Intelligence (DRI). According to IANS report, the value of the ganja seized from Rajiv Gandhi International Airport (RGIA) in Shamshabad is said to be Rs 8.9 crore. The action team has seized it from a passenger who had come from Bangkok. Smuggling of hydrophonic ganja has increased in recent times.

According to officials, this banned material was recovered during the search of the passenger’s luggage. Two people have been arrested in this entire case.Action has been taken against the accused under NDPS Act. Now the question is, what is hydroponic hemp, how different is it from normal hemp and what does the law say on it?

What is hydroponic hemp?

This is a special variety of ganja. Generally the hemp plant is grown in soil, but the hydroponic hemp plant is grown in a special kind of solution. Because it is grown through hydroponic technology, it is also called hydro hemp.

The hydroponics in which hemp is grown contain special types of nutrients. Its plants are kept in a special environment so that their growth is fast and the plant is clean. It is grown commercially in this manner.

The hemp plant that grows in water with specific nutrients also has its own characteristics. Due to its separation from the soil, the risk of diseases occurring in the plant is eliminated. There is no need for pest control. While growing it, temperature, light, pH and humidity are controlled. Its roots are strong. Flowers appear in less time. Their nutritional capacity is better.

Why is it becoming popular, where is it legal?

Hydroponic marijuana is becoming popular for many reasons. It grows faster than soil based plants. Its development cycle is fast. It is legal in many countries of the world, but it is important to note that permission has been given to use it in the medical sector. It is legal in New Zealand, Canada, Australia, Czech Republic, USA, Germany, Chile, Mexico, Italy, Israel and Thailand, but there are many conditions associated with it.

What does the law say in India?

Generally it is of two types. Sativa and Indica. Both are used for medicine and intoxication. Hybrid Ganja, Sativa and Indica have been prepared scientifically. These are crossbreeds. At the same time, hydroponic hemp grown in water is considered better in terms of properties. This is the reason why its smuggling is more. There is a proper law for ganja in India.

The Narcotic Drugs and Psychotropic Substances (NDPS) Act says that even possession of a small amount of ganja can lead to imprisonment of up to one year or a fine of up to Rs 10,000 or both, but the accused can get bail from the police station.
